Sliding window installation services involve replacing or upgrading existing windows with new, modern sliding units. These services typically include removing old windows, preparing the opening for the new installation, and securely fitting the sliding sash windows to ensure smooth operation. Many contractors also offer options for customizing the size, frame material, and glass features to match the aesthetic and functional needs of a property. This process can help improve the overall appearance of a home while enhancing the functionality of the windows, making them easier to open and close compared to traditional styles.

Properties that often benefit from sliding window installation include single-family homes, townhouses, and apartment complexes. These windows are popular in residential settings because they provide a wide view and easy access to outdoor spaces like patios or decks. Sliding windows are also suitable for areas where space is limited, as they do not require extra room to swing open like casement or double-hung windows. Commercial buildings or multi-family residences may also use sliding windows for their durability and low maintenance needs, making them a practical choice for various property types.

The overview below groups typical Sliding Windows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Allendale,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or sliding window repairs, such as replacing hardware or seals, usually range from $100 to $300. Many routine fixes fall within this lower band, though prices can vary based on window size and part availability.
Standard Installation - Installing new sliding windows in a standard home generally costs between $250 and $600 per window. Most projects in Allendale, MI, land in this middle range, with fewer jobs reaching higher prices due to added features or complexity.
Full Replacement - Complete replacement of multiple or larger sliding windows can range from $1,000 to $3,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ects or premium window choices tend to push costs into the higher end of this spectrum.
Custom or High-End Projects - High-end or custom sliding window installations, including specialty designs or larger sizes, can exceed $5,000. These projects are less common and typically involve additional features or structural modifications.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are sliding windows? Sliding windows are a type of window that open horizontally by sliding along a track, providing easy operation and a wide view.
